9 Loughborough Road, Leicester
Reg Number: 11807006
Date of Inc: February 05, 2019
3 LOUGHBOROUGH ROAD, LEICESTER
Reg Number: 06248387
Date of Inc: January 01, 1970
19-25 Loughborough Road, Leicester
Reg Number: 14632409
Date of Inc: February 01, 2023
3 LOUGHBOROUGH ROAD, LEICESTER
Reg Number: 06248393
Date of Inc: January 01, 1970
15 LOUGHBOROUGH ROAD, LEICESTER
Reg Number: 07711589
Date of Inc: January 01, 1970